Stability 01 : (1) (Phys) The tendency to remain in a given state or condition. Note: A stable dynamic system possesses restoring forces that return it to its equilibrium state when it is disturbed by an outside force. (2) (Chem) The resistance of a chemical compound to decomposition. (3) (Build; Brit) The capacity to resist failure when exposed to shock, stress, or other severe condition. A measure characterizing the lasting quality of building construction elements, and the like, under fire conditions. Note: In a fire-resistance test stability is measured to the time of collapse for nonbearing constructions; to the time of deflection exceeding specified limits for horizontal constructions; and to 80% of the time to collapse for load-bearing constructions, or to 80% of the heating time if collapse occurs in the reload test
